Achieving reliable heat shrink terminations requires a methodical approach and the utilization of appropriate tools. The process involves carefully prepping the conductor, selecting the proper size of heat shrink tubing, and applying heat to guarantee a tight and secure fit.
Proper treatment of the conductor is crucial to prevent issues down the line. Stripping insulation to the appropriate length and ensuring smooth edges are vital for successful heat shrink performance.
- Utilizing a consistent application of heat is key to achieving a complete shrink. Overheating can damage the insulation, while insufficient heat will lead to a inadequate fit.
- Evaluate environmental factors like temperature and humidity, as they can affect the shrinking process.
- Implementing a dedicated heat gun with adjustable temperature settings allows for accurate heat application.
By observing these best practices, technicians can confirm that heat shrink terminations are both reliable and satisfying industry standards.

Fine-Tuning Heat Shrink for Indoor Applications
When identifying heat shrink get more info tubing for indoor applications, consider the precise requirements of your task. Factors such as voltage rating, wall thickness, and ambient temperature will determine the optimal choice. For secure connections in low-voltage circuits, thinner walled tubing may be adequate. In contrast, for higher voltage applications or conditions with harsh temperatures, thicker walled tubing is critical to ensure adequate insulation and protection.
- Focus on materials with a high dielectric strength to prevent electrical breakdowns.
- Opt for heat shrink tubing that is compatible with the materials of your connections.
- Confirm proper application to achieve a tight and secure seal.
